The Gun: Walther P99

In "Casino Royale," James Bond, portrayed by Daniel Craig, carries the Walther P99 as his primary weapon. The Walther P99 is a semi-automatic, polymer-framed, striker-fired pistol known for its advanced design, ergonomic features, and modular construction. Its sleek and modern aesthetics make it a perfect fit for Bond's character, emphasizing his sophistication and lethal capabilities.

The Walther P99 has been a popular choice for law enforcement and military personnel around the world. Its reputation for reliability, accuracy, and versatility has contributed to its widespread adoption.
